My 8 month old desert baby eats for about 45min to 1hr every morn and then also wants more in the evening is that ok or too much?

Just be certain the tortoise has adequate space to walk/exercise enough. I cannot tell you how much the tortoise should walk. But tortoises can get over weight. Typically young ones are just fine, and active. Just offering something to take into consideration. Monitoring activity of your tortoises is a very easy thing to oversee, especially with work, schedules, etc.. But yes feed away.
